Output 91d717aa3a356ec9320c931e510ac5ee6559755eb1b1344cb53742a6e705a00a:0

value
304888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ca3ab077a1f8e23ac38b4d65f556d36b9037e69 OP_EQUAL
address
3JtT2Txdm63K8k6hQvLqYWCaP3oC3cknNL
transaction
91d717aa3a356ec9320c931e510ac5ee6559755eb1b1344cb53742a6e705a00a
confirmations
156954
spent
true